- Reposted by William F. Tulloch#ResistanceRoots Today in history, 1918: Henry Johnson and Needham Roberts become the first Americans to receive the French Croix de Guerre. Members of the African American 369th Infantry Regiment, they defended their position against an onslaught of Germans, holding the French line. /1

- Reposted by William F. TullochMy latest for @theappeal.org: James Carver spent 36 years in prison after he was convicted of setting one of the deadliest fires in #Massachusetts history. But after reviewing new scientific evidence, a judge set him free. “They took my life away for nothing,” Carver said.

- Reposted by William F. TullochAs fire truck prices hit $2 million, US firefighters demand an antitrust probe. The largest firefighters' labor union in the U.S. is demanding antitrust authorities investigate the companies that make fire trucks, skyrocketing costs & years-long wait times. www.reuters.com/sustainabili...
